Understanding the Basics: JavaScript and Cookies
JavaScript is a powerful scripting language integral to today’s website functionalities, used for creating interactive elements and dynamic content. Conversely, cookies are small data packets helping websites remember user preferences, aiding in personalizing the user experience.
Without JavaScript and cookies, users might encounter incomplete webpage loadings or inactive features, impacting a site’s usability. Acknowledging these challenges, the tech community encourages Valley residents to optimize their browser settings accordingly.
Making Necessary Browser Adjustments
For many RGV residents, accessing their browser settings to enable JavaScript is a straightforward process: locate privacy settings and allow JavaScript. Although steps vary between browsers, these adjustments are crucial for accessing essential services.
Similarly, enabling cookies involves adjusting browser privacy settings to allow the desired range of cookie storage—from allowing all to blocking third-party cookies, or creating exceptions for specific sites.

Security Concerns in South Texas
Yet, amid suggestions to enable these features, security and privacy concerns persist, especially among those wary of online data tracking. Cookies, for instance, can log user behavior, sparking debates over privacy.
Jose Rodriguez, a cybersecurity expert in McAllen, urges a balanced approach. “For Valley residents, understanding security implications is vital. It’s about optimizing settings to enhance experience while safeguarding privacy—like disabling third-party cookies,” he advises.
Furthermore, maintaining the latest browser updates is essential for security patches and compatibility with dynamic content. Many websites offer guidance within their pages, simplifying user compliance.
